Regina F MEIGHAN was born 14 February 1918 in Providence, Rhode Island, USA

Regina F MEIGHAN was the child of John Francis MEIGHAN   and   Rose Anna FARRELL and the grandchild of: (paternal)  John J MEIGHAN and Annie T RATTIGAN

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Regina F  married  John A SILVIA abt. 1944 .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
John A SILVIA  was born 15 March 1913 in Newport, Rhode Island, USA.  John A died 5 March 1969 in Providence, Rhode Island, USA.  John A was the child of John S SILVIA and Minnie T CLARKE.

Regina F MEIGHAN died 30 June 1967 in Providence, Rhode Island, USA.

Invention The microwave oven was invented accidentally in 1945 by Percy Spencer, a Raytheon engineer. While testing a magnetron, he noticed microwaves melted a candy bar in his pocket. Experimenting further, he discovered microwaves could cook food quickly. Raytheon patented the process, and by 1947, they built the first commercial microwave oven, called the 'Radarange.' Initially used in commercial settings, microwaves becomes affordable for home use by the 1960s and 1970s, revolutionizing cooking.

News1962 - The Cuban Missile Crisis was a tense 13-day standoff in October 1962 between the United States and the Soviet Union over the installation of Soviet nuclear missiles in Cuba, just 90 miles from the U.S. coast. The crisis is considered the closest the Cold War came to escalating into a full-scale nuclear war. It began when American spy planes discovered the missiles, leading to a U.S. naval blockade of Cuba and intense negotiations. The crisis ended when Soviet Premier Nikita Khrushchev agreed to remove the missiles in exchange for the U.S. promising not to invade Cuba and secretly agreeing to remove American missiles from Turkey.
